1 /* alloc.c - version 1.0.2 */
2 /* $FreeBSD: src/games/hack/alloc.c,v 1.4 1999/11/16 02:57:01 billf Exp $ */
3 /* $DragonFly: src/games/hack/alloc.c,v 1.3 2004/11/06 12:29:17 eirikn Exp $ */
10 a ridiculous definition, suppressing
11 "possible pointer alignment problem" for (long *) malloc()
12 "enlarg defined but never used"
13 "ftell defined (in <stdio.h>) but never used"
18 alloc(n) unsigned n; {
19 long dummy = ftell(stderr);
20 if(n) dummy = 0; /* make sure arg is used */
32 if(!(ptr = malloc(lth)))
33 panic("Cannot get %d bytes", lth);
44 if(!(nptr = realloc(ptr,lth)))
45 panic("Cannot reallocate %d bytes", lth);
46 return((long *) nptr);